Latest Patents
William C Von Meyer holds a patent for 4-alkyl-1,2,4-4H-triazole derivatives. This patent includes substituted 1,2,4-4H-triazoles of the formula wherein R¹ and R² are hydrogen atoms, and R³ is alkyl, alkenyl, alkynyl, cycloalkyl, benzyl, or phenyl. These compounds are recognized for their effectiveness as fungicides, particularly in controlling cereal rust.
